vimarsana.com
Home
Essex Computer Consumer Electronics
Top Locations Tagged with Essex Computer Consumer Electronics
Essex Computer Consumer Electronics in United States - 07078/Consumer-electronics near Essex
1). Absolute Computer Technologies, John F Kennedy Pkwy Ste F
vimarsana © 2020. All Rights Reserved.